Centrl: Free Location Based Social Network with a Small Twist

centrl Robert let me know about Centrl which is another slick looking location based social network. The problem with most of these networks is that you need to have friends on them to be tempted to install it. Google got this easily with Google Maps since so many people already have it installed for Latitude. Centrl seems to be very similar where you can share you location with friends and let them find you.

The app differentiates a bit by helping you find new people and places to go around you that are happening. The most important feature in my opinion is that it lets you login with your Facebook, MySpace, Hi5, Ning, Orkut, Bebo or Friendster and it is integrated with Twitter. Personally I think that is a big twist in that you really do not need to register for their service separately from your regular social network. They also have iPhone and Android apps for you to keep tabs of your friends on those devices.
